Job Overview
Applications are invited to apply for the post of Senior Ophthalmic Specialist grade in Medical Retina and Urgent Care Service within Moorfields Eye Hospital NHS Foundation Trust. The position is full‑time and based at the Moorfields satellite unit within Croydon University Hospital (CUH), involving eight direct patient care sessions as part of a multidisciplinary team.
Main Duties
- Be medically qualified, maintain GMC specialist registration and hold a licence to practice.
- Develop and maintain the competencies required to carry out the duties of the post.
- Ensure prompt attendance at agreed direct clinical care programmed activities.
- Engage patients in decisions about their care and respond to their views.

Person Specification
Education and Qualifications
- MBBS or equivalent medical qualification.
- MRCOphth or equivalent.
- Full GMC Registration (with a Licence to Practice) or eligibility for GMC Registration.
Knowledge & Experience
- Wide experience in the Medical Retina subspecialty.
- Experience in urgent eye care and emergency ophthalmology management.
- Experience of leading management decisions in medical retina injection clinics.
- Four years full‑time postgraduate training, at least two of which must be in the Ophthalmology Specialty Training Programme or have equivalent experience & competencies.
